📝 Color Information for #EBD9C2

The hexadecimal color code #EBD9C2 represents a very light shade in the orange family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 235 red, 217 green, and 194 blue, which translates to approximately 92% red, 85% green, and 76%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#EBD9C2 has a hue of 34 degrees, a saturation level of 51%, and a lightness value of 84%. The hue angle of 34° places this color firmly in the orange sp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 34°, saturation of 17%, and brightness/value of 92%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#EBD9C2 would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 8% magenta, 17% yellow, and 8% black. The closest web-safe color is #FFCCCC,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. As a lighter shade, it's excellent for backgrounds, negative space, and creating a sense of openness in designs.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#EBD9C2 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 214°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 15456706,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#EBD9C2? +

The approximate CMYK value of #EBD9C2 is C:0% M:8% Y:17% K:8%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
